Welcome to King William

A beautiful, historic neighborhood with 19th-century architecture
 
King William is a historic community famous for its ornate 19th-century buildings. The neighborhood is located along the San Antonio River in the Southtown Arts district and is home to beautiful mansions, cozy coffeehouses, and art studios.
 
The area is bounded by South St. Mary's, Durango, Cesar Chavez Boulevard, and Eagleland. In 1950, the area began attracting many people due to its proximity to the downtown business district. As a result, the old houses were renovated into small cottages, and the neighborhood expanded to include new modern buildings between S. Alamo and South St. Mary's Streets.

Things to Do

There is tons to do in King William, especially if you love exploring historical sites and outdoor activities. First, you can visit the Guenther House, originally built in 1859, and one of King William's oldest buildings. You can then walk into San Antonio Art League and Museum, which houses over 600 artistic works. Villa Finale: Museum & Gardens, the last home of local preservationist Walter Nold Mathis, is also a good place to check out. Next, you can visit Beethoven Maennerchor, a beer garden, and the Anton Wulf House, the headquarters of the San Antonio Conservation Society.
 
King Willam is also home to beautiful parks, including Roosevelt Park with a public pool, Chris Park, established in 2005, and King William Park to walk, play, or relax. The King William Fair is the most popular event in the neighborhood, which brings people together to fundraise to protect and preserve the historical community. Brackenridge Park Golf Course, Olmos Basin Golf Course, and Riverside Golf Course are some fantastic places to enjoy golf.
